thinking of buying a EK FLUID GAMING A240

the cooling liquid that came with the kit is a EK-CryoFuel clear

but is it possible to get a EK-CryoFuel in green and mix it in the build?

since the kit was made of aluminum so im a bit worried.

also, is there anyway to make ek send them both together?

caz im living in Hong Kong and the shipping is really pricey.

There is nothing special about the clear cryofuel included in the kit. its the off the shelf stuff they sell in other colours as well... not idea about combined shipping though, you may wish to contact EK about that if you're having issue making a shopping cart for it. They are extending the "fluid gaming" product line by the end of the month here (or so they say) so perhaps this is something they will address then.

Ok so basically they sent me a email and told me that they couldn't put that in the kit

but i can buy an extra bottle of cooling liquid in EK's shop

i can tell them in email to send me the kit + the extra cooling liquid to me in the same shipping

in that way, i only have to pay 1 shipping instead of 2

they will refund the money back to my card after that.
